
HONOURABLE Adebo Ogundoyin, Speaker, Oyo State House of Assembly, on Saturday, emerged the new Chairman of the Conference of Speakers of State Legislatures of Nigeria.
At the national meeting of the conference held in Abuja, Ogundoyin emerged following the withdrawal of the Speaker, Ogun State House of Assembly, Honourable Taiwo Oluomo.
Ogundoyin’s emergence was, thereafter, confirmed through a unanimous voice vote by the conference.
Ogundoyin emerged for a two-year tenure succeeding Speaker of the Bauchi State House of Assembly, Honourable Abubakar Suleiman.
